To achieve legal security in people's transactions and to be embodied on the ground, the matter necessitates the existence of a set of pillars and basic components that comprise the pillar of legal security which are as follows: 1. Judicial review refers to the power of the courts to legally examine the current and prior laws that Congress passes and/or actions the executive branch of government takes to determine if they violate any laws or the U.S. Constitution. The Concept of the Legal Security Principle: Legal security, in general, can be defined as a process aimed at providing a state of stability in legal relations and status by issuing legislation under the constitution and compatible with the principles of international law, to promote confidence and reassurance among the parties to legal relations, so that legislation must not be marked by surprises, turmoil, or conflict. This principle implies that public authorities are obligated to ensure a measure of stability in legal relations as well as a minimum level of stability for legal status so that people can act confidently under existing legal rules and regulations, whether at work or elsewhere, and arrange their working conditions accordingly, without being subjected to sudden actions that undermine their legitimate expectations and destabilize their legal (Aqili, 2019). Judicial powers include interpreting federal laws and the U.S. Constitution, deciding cases on appeal from lower federal or state courts and deciding cases involving a state-vs.-state issue or a branch-vs.-branch issue. The United States Supreme Court leads the judicial branch, which also includes all lower federal courts. The justices are nominated by the president but must be approved by the Senate. Generally, legal security can be defined as a process aimed at providing a state of stability in legal relations and status by issuing legislation in conformity with the constitution and compatible with the principles of international law, to attain confidence and reassurance among the parties to legal relations, so that legislation must not be characterized by surprises, turmoil, or excessive texts or retroactive laws and decisions (Assar, 2003).
